Merlot is more dynamic, more natural sounding, greater sound density with fine details not heard on dac07. Merlot is both higher resolution and more analog sounding. Think of Merlot as dCS Lina in terms of dynamics and sound density but is more analog sounding and higher level of micro details (not as smoothed over as Lina). Aeris has greater macro dynamic than Merlot and greater bass slam but Aeris' problem is it's missing the finer details and micro dynamics and it sounds more "digital" than either Merlot or dac07 - you know the kind of etched digital sound that many hate (including myself).
